Louis Armando Pena Soltren Arrested in 1968 Hijacking

Full story: www.nytimes.com

A fugitive who has been living in Cuba for four decades to avoid prosecution for his role in an airline hijacking surrendered to federal law enforcement authorities in New York on Sunday, ending his distinction of being one of the F.B.I. 's longest-known fugitives.
